The purpose of the work is to study the practice of applying the main methods of procurement of educational services – auction and competition and to identify a method that gives a greater economic effect. The paper applies general scientific research methods comparison and analysis and the method of expert assessments. The author considers the shortcomings of the purchase of educational services additional professional education by an open auction, which, providing a low contract price (savings) does not make it possible to select an application with the highest quality offer and a qualified executor. The author draws attention to the fact that the efficiency of procurement – one of the most important principles of the contract system – requires from the customer not only economy, but also efficiency. Hence, as an effective way of purchasing such services, an open tender in electronic form is proposed, which makes it possible to achieve the best result. Using a budget-defined amount of money. Recommendations are given on the preparation of a tender with regard to the calculation of the initial (maximum) price of the contract, the description of the subject matter of the procurement and the evaluation criteria. Amendments to the current legislation are proposed to introduce the compulsory use of a tender for these procurements. This is the first time such a study has been carried out in the context of the adoption of the optimisation package of amendments to the legislation on the contractual system. The amendments to the legislation on the contract system coming into effect from 01.01.2021 introduce major changes in the regulation of tenders (more than 20 articles have lost their force, three new articles have been introduced, which determine the order of tendering), which requires further research on the procurement of VET services by open electronic tendering. The work can be useful for state and municipal customers and other purchasers of educational services.
